Mediation</h3>
Mediation is a structured, interactive process where an impartial third party assists disputing parties in resolving conflict through the use of specialized communication and negotiation techniques. All participants in mediation are encouraged to actively participate in the process.
<h3>
What does mediate mean by law?</h3>
Simply put, mediation is a negotiation between disputing parties, assisted by a neutral. While the mediator is not empowered to impose a settlement, the mediator's presence alters the dynamics of the negotiation and often helps shape the final settlement.

The temporal lobe is the part of the brain where the processing of auditory information, sound, takes place. Since the information you receive when the instructor is making the announcement is audio, in his speech, it is processed in the temporal lobe. It is also where the primary auditory cortex is located which is responsible for converting auditory information into words and sentences to make it understandable.
